titleOfInvention |
Three-dimensional cell spheroid with high proliferation activity, and the producing method and use therefor |
abstract |
The present invention discloses a three-dimensional cell spheroid with high proliferation activity, and the cell spheroid is obtained by ejecting a cell cluster through a needle with a needle gauge less than 30G. The present invention further provides the producing method and the use for the cell spheroid. |
